Originally Posted by wimprezax06
im planning on tint my windows how much did you guys pay for? i called omega and they

said $180, and also whats the different between those metalic and non-matalic films?
Metallic fims are actually tinted with a metallic material. It will not discolor or fade. Non-metallic is a dyed film. It will usually turn purple after time.
